NiCE to Buy Cognigy
NiCE (NASDAQ: NICE), a NYC-based company which specializes in AI-powered customer experience, acquired Cognigy, a Düsseldorf, Germany-based conversational and agentic AI company. The amount of the deal was not disclosed. Scientists Teach AI to Think About the Roman Empire
Historians don’t know when the Ancient Roman text “Res Gestae Divi Augusti,” a chronicle of Emperor Augustus’s deeds, was first written, since these kind of epigraphs tend to not contain any written dates.
